 | | At the University these include the Center of Alcohol Studies, the Eating Disorders Clinic, the Institute for Health Care, Health Care Policy, and Aging Research, laboratories for the study of stress and coping, and the Douglass Developmental Disabilities Center. |
 | | In addition to university practica, a wide range of external practicum sites are available in the surrounding community, including community mental health centers, medical centers, and other specialized clinical centers. |
 | | Students are required to complete core courses, including a two semester clinical proseminar, a two course sequence in research design and statistics, adult psychopathology, clinical and research ethics, cognitive assessment, behavioral neurosciences, personality theory, social psychology and cognitive psychology, and a minimum of two therapy methods courses. |
